 | | Soul man Gerald LeVert had an auspicious childhood as the son of RandB legend Eddie LeVert, the lead singer of the O’Jays, and the choice gene pool seemed to kick in at an early age. |
 | | Gerald’s voice was a near dead-ringer for his father’s distinctive, growling baritone, and his engaging lead took the group to the Pop and Soul top five with their Atlantic debut single, “Casanova,” an infectious midtempo tune written for the group by Midnight Star’s Calloway brothers. |
 | | Gerald was developing as a songwriter and vocalist, and fronted LeVert through a string of top Soul hits over the next few years, including #1s “My Forever Love,” “Just Coolin’” and “Baby I’m Ready.” However, his development also moved him into a first-among-equals status that invariably led to a solo singing career. |
